SEREMBAN – Negri Sembilan police contingent headquarters Criminal Investigation Department (CID) chief Ramlan Abdul Razak, 59, died at Tuanku Ja’afar Hospital (HTJ) at 1.35am today.
State police chief Datuk Mohamad Mat Yusop said Ramlan was confirmed positive for Covid-19 on August 8 and treated at HTJ, but he tested negative before he died.
“His internal organs failed to function properly due to the effects of Covid-19,” he told Bernama today.
He said Ramlan’s death is a big loss to state police especially, its CID.
He described Ramlan as a kind but firm person with wide experience in crime investigation.
Ramlan, who had served the force for more than 30 years, had been due to retire on October 9.
His remains were laid to rest at the Senawang Muslim cemetery about 11am.
He is survived by his wife and their 10 children. – Bernama, September 12, 2021
